Using A Company to Save Tax – 2009 Update
By running your business through a limited company you can save tens of thousands of pounds in tax and national insurance.
Why? To start with UK corporation tax rates are often much lower than income tax rates. Secondly, company owners can pay themselves dividends, which are taxed much less heavily than...
